There is a podcast which I have used successfully. It’s called ( surprisingly enough) Bridgeto10k. Its made by Bluefin Software and is free- even though it says Subscribe beside it. It’s a 6 week plan, and goes back to run/walk but I found it great for building up to 10k again after my injury. You get told when to run and walk and “ you have 5 mins left” etc. And the music is bearable ( much like C25k).

Also I found if you download the podcasts at home, you don’t have them cut out on you like the App seemed to do now and then.
